This 10-pound container of 60/90 coarse silicon carbide grit is the essential first step for any rock tumbling project. Compatible with all rock tumblers and polishers, it delivers fast, effective shaping to prepare stones for subsequent polishing stages. The coarse grit is what I expected it to be and the price is a plus. My only complaint is that @$#% little metal shovel that is packed inside on top of the inner plastic bag. In the bucket I received the shovel cut the bag and grit leaked out. When pulling the top of the zip-tied some of the grit fell out. That little shovel is useless for dispensing the grit as it falls off the shallow pan. Unless you have the steady hands of a surgeon you will spill it. I recommend the small plastic dipping cups found in food supplement containers to handle tumbling grit.
